Sound & Light Technician

Rate of Pay: $17.75 - $19.50 

Hours: Fall/Winter Up to 15hrs/week Summer: Up to 35hrs/week 

Work Location: York University Markham Campus – 1 University Blvd, Markham, ON 

Job Purpose: 

The Sound & Light Technician is responsible for setting up and operating technical equipment at events and theatre productions. 

Job Duties: 

Under the direction of a permanent staff member, the Sound & Light Technician may be responsible for some or all the following tasks: 

  • Provide audio, visual, and lighting support services. 
  • Set-up, operate and strike AV components, lighting and stage equipment as directed by the event organizer. 
  • Adhere to safety protocols. 
  • Support faculty, staff, students and guest speaker’s with technical equipment requirements and special requests. 
  • Collaborate with clients and staff members to interpret and translate ideas into imaginative sound and lighting aesthetics. 
  • Conduct regular and seasonal inventory of technical equipment. 
  • Maintain organization of studio booth. 
  • Assist with technical and dress rehearsals. 
  • Schedule and track rehearsal requests to ensure efficient use of studio space. 
  • Attend and participate in regular team meetings. 
  • Assists with special projects and administrative duties. 
  • Other duties as assigned.
